Practice Work Shop (PWS) On “Does The Rise Of Digital Media Branding Threaten The Value Of Well-Known Trademarks?”

Featuring: Nivrati Gupta

During the last PWS session, Nivrati Gupta, Associate, hosted a discussion on “Does the Rise of Digital Media Branding Threaten the Value of Well-Known Trademarks?” The participants examined whether statutory recognition of well-known marks, long considered the pinnacle of brand protection, still provides the same strategic advantage in a digital marketplace shaped by algorithms, search rankings, and consumer engagement. The session explored how IP frameworks might adapt to protect brands in an environment where “brand spikes” and viral trends create significant equity outside of traditional, long-term use. It also addressed how brand narratives are increasingly shaped by user-generated content and social media, prompting questions about the strategies brands can adopt to maintain value beyond formal legal recognition. The discussion emphasized that while statutory protection remains crucial for enforcement, digital consumer recognition has become equally vital to a brand’s survival and growth.
